abstract="The effects of suspension properties, particularly roll steer and compliance steer, on vehicle stability in a cross wind are examined using measurements of the vehicle's roll angle and steer angles of the front and rear wheels when the vehicle is subjected to a lateral wind. Further consideration is made with a simulation model. The following main results are obtained: 1) The roll angle and the cornering forces of the front and rear wheels exhibit a transient reversal of direction in a cross wind. 2) Accompanying this vehicle behaviour, the roll steer and compliance steer of the rear wheels, in particular, have substantially different effects on cross wind stability.<p />",
